About this role

The Vice President of Go-to-Market Europe at iCapital will lead the sales efforts for the Passthrough business targeting non-advised investors across the UK and Europe. This role involves full-cycle sales from prospecting to closing, building partnerships with fund administrators and law firms, and acting as the product expert in the European private funds landscape. The position requires regular travel for client and partner meetings, and the candidate will be responsible for meeting a significant revenue quota while developing the market strategy.

What you need

  • 8+ years in full-cycle B2B sales, business development, or partnerships
  • Demonstrated record of generating, running, and signing new business
  • Track record of carrying and meeting an individual revenue quota
  • Established relationships with general partners, fund administrators, and/or fund formation counsel in the UK and Europe
  • Fluency in private markets with the ability to engage with fund COOs, General Counsel, or Investor Relations leads
  • Comfort operating with ambiguity

Nice to have

  • Experience selling to or through channel partners
  • Experience at an early-stage or high-growth company
  • Experience on the allocator side, whether at an LP, fund of funds, investment consultancy, or placement agent
  • German or French language ability
